The United States Postal Service (USPS) offers a variety of direct mailing services to help businesses and individuals send targeted and personalized mailings. Here are some of the most popular USPS direct mailing services:

  1. Every Door Direct Mail (EDDM): This service allows you to send mailings to every address in a specific geographic area, without needing to purchase a mailing list. You can target specific neighborhoods, cities, or zip codes.
  2. Targeted Mailing Lists: USPS offers a range of mailing lists that can be customized to your specific needs. You can choose from lists of households, businesses, or consumers based on demographics, interests, and behaviors.
  3. Presort Services: USPS offers presort services that can help you save time and money by sorting and preparing your mailings for delivery. You can choose from a range of presort options, including automated and manual sorting.
  4. Mailpiece Design and Printing: USPS offers design and printing services for your mailpieces, including business reply mail, coupons, and other types of mail.
  5. Mailing Software: USPS offers a range of mailing software solutions that can help you manage your mailings, including address validation, sorting, and tracking.
  6. Delivery Confirmation: This service provides proof of delivery for your mailpieces, including electronic confirmation of delivery and a tracking number.
  7. Signature Confirmation: This service requires the recipient to sign for the mailpiece, providing proof of delivery and a tracking number.
  8. Return Service Requested: This service allows you to request that undeliverable mailpieces be returned to you, rather than being discarded.
